How to Build Autonomous AI Agents for Real-World Applications

“`html

How to Build Autonomous AI Agents for Real-World Applications

Introduction

Autonomous AI agents are revolutionizing how we approach problem-solving in various fields. They operate independently, making decisions based on data and learned experiences. With the increasing demand for automation, understanding the importance of autonomy in AI applications has never been more critical.

Understanding Autonomous AI Agents

Defining autonomous AI agents is essential to grasping their potential. These agents can operate without human intervention, utilizing algorithms that allow them to learn and adapt over time.

  • Key characteristics of autonomy in AI:
  • Self-direction: Ability to make decisions based on input data.
  • Adaptability: Learning from experiences to improve performance.
  • Interactivity: Engaging with users and other systems effectively.

Core Technologies for Building AI Agents

Several core technologies form the backbone of autonomous AI agents:

  • Machine learning fundamentals: Understanding supervised, unsupervised, and reinforcement learning methods.
  • Natural language processing: Enabling agents to understand and generate human language.
  • Robotics integration: Merging AI with robotics for physical interaction with the environment.

Steps to Build an Autonomous AI Agent

  1. Define the problem: Clearly outline the objectives and goals of the AI agent.
  2. Choose the right technology stack: Select tools and frameworks based on the agent’s requirements.
  3. Data collection and preparation: Gather and preprocess the data necessary for training the model.
  4. Model training and evaluation: Train the model and assess its performance using various metrics.

Testing and Validating AI Agents

Testing is crucial for ensuring the reliability of AI agents. Effective validation involves:

  • Importance of testing in AI: Identifying issues before deployment.
  • Validation methods for AI performance: Utilizing metrics such as accuracy, precision, and recall.
  • Real-world testing scenarios: Simulating environments to assess agent performance.

Deployment of AI Agents

Deploying AI agents requires careful planning and execution:

  • Best practices for deploying AI agents: Ensuring scalability and reliability.
  • Monitoring and maintenance post-deployment: Continuously assessing performance and updating as necessary.

Case Studies

Real-world applications provide valuable insights into building autonomous AI agents:

  • Examples of successful autonomous AI agents: Highlighting innovations in various industries.
  • Lessons learned from real-world applications: Identifying best practices and common pitfalls.

Challenges in Building Autonomous AI Agents

While building autonomous AI agents holds great promise, several challenges must be addressed:

  • Technical and ethical challenges: Navigating the complexities of AI development.
  • Overcoming common obstacles: Strategies to mitigate risks and enhance reliability.

FAQ

  • What is an autonomous AI agent? Autonomous AI agents are computer programs capable of making decisions without human intervention.
  • How do I start building an AI agent? Begin by defining the problem and selecting the appropriate technology stack.
  • What technologies are best for AI agents? Machine learning, natural language processing, and robotics are essential technologies for AI agents.
  • How do I test my AI agent’s performance? Use validation methods such as accuracy and recall to assess your AI agent’s effectiveness.
  • What are the ethical considerations in AI autonomy? Consider issues such as bias, transparency, and accountability in the decision-making process.

“`

Leave a Reply

Your email address will not be published. Required fields are marked *